Abstract :
This paper presents the results in modeling, technological realization and measurements of a zeroth- order resonating antenna based on CRLH (composite right/left-handed) transmission lines. The CRLH consists of series connected CPW interdigital capacitors and parallel connected CPW transmission lines. The studied devices were fabricated on silicon substrate for a subsequent integration in a more complex circuit. A very good agreement between the simulation data and the experimental results has been found out in the 10 - 14 GHz frequency domain.
